Aurantiol is a long lasting sweet-floral raw material which is reminiscent of orange blossom. It's the most famous example of a "Schiff's base" in perfumery, made from the reaction of hydroxycitronellal with methyl anthranilate. Aurantiol is classically used in Cologne style (fresh citrus) compositions, however is also finds other uses in the modern perfumery palette as a versatile mid note.
